There are many reasons why counselling can be a crucial component of dealing with obesity. Ava bring up part of it with instant gratification; I want to eat that and I want to eat it now and I don't care if it isn't healthy for me. And as the authors of the study say, in another few minutes or steps there will be more food right there for the taking.

For people who eat for emotional reasons, counselling can help identify and provide strategies to change the behaviour.

For people who are in denial of what is really involved in lasting weight loss, a nutritional counsellor may be more valuable. It does come down to burn more calories than you consume. Don't want to change what you consume? Then you need to burn more. It really is that simple. Almost everyone can find a way to move their body more, even though it might be uncomfortable or even painful to start. But it can be done.

It has to be a lifestyle change for both food and activity. It goes beyond just handing a diet and exercise plan out and expecting people to want to change. It's not

possible to see the benefit in a two step process. I see two issues: the inexpensiveness and availabity of fast food and sedentary lifestyles. Actually I see a third issue and it's really a societal issue. We have An overwhelming need to have everything instantly. Weightloss is aongterm process. It's not going to happen in a day or a week. It's taken me nearly two years to lose 60 lb, accounting for 29 percent of my body weight. Although the height/weight charts say I'm overweight, Im only 23 percent body fat, which isn't too bad. I reaaly needed to se realistc expectations for weight loss which in hindsight was most of the battle.
